Patent number: 10456828Abstract: A forged crankshaft production method includes a first preforming step, a second preforming step, and a final preforming step. The first pair of dies includes web processing parts to come into contact with portions to be formed into arms and portions to be formed into weights integrated with the arms. Each of the web processing parts includes an arm processing part and a weight processing part. The arm processing part and the weight processing part form a recessed portion, and the width of the open side of the weight processing part becomes greater with increasing distance from the bottom of the recessed portion. Accordingly, in the blank, volume can be distributed between a portion to be formed into an arm and a portion to be formed into a weight integrated with the arm, and the material yield rate can be improved.Type: GrantFiled: March 18, 2016Date of Patent: October 29, 2019Assignee: NIPPON STEEL CORPORATIONInventors: Junichi Okubo, Kenji Tamura, Kunihiro Yoshida, Samsoo Hwang, Ryusuke Nakano, Masao Hori

Patent number: 10456833Abstract: A variety of additive manufacturing techniques can be adapted to fabricate a substantially net shape object from a computerized model using materials that can be debound and sintered into a fully dense metallic part or the like. However, during sintering, the net shape will shrink as binder escapes and the base material fuses into a dense final part. If the foundation beneath the object does not shrink in a corresponding fashion, the resulting stresses throughout the object can lead to fracturing, warping or other physical damage to the object resulting in a failed fabrication. To address this issue, a variety of techniques are disclosed for substrates and build plates that contract in a manner complementary to the object during debinding and sintering.Type: GrantFiled: January 11, 2018Date of Patent: October 29, 2019Assignee: Desktop Metals, Inc.Inventors: Michael Andrew Gibson, Jonah Samuel Myerberg, Ricardo Fulop, Ricardo Chin, Matthew David Verminski, Richard Remo Fontana, Christopher Allan Schuh, Yet-Ming Chiang, Anastasios John Hart

Patent number: 10456852Abstract: The present invention improves the stability of welding conditions in a welding method that involves cyclically repeating forward feed and reverse feed of a welding wire. Provided is an arc welding control method involving cyclic repetition of forward feed and reverse feed of a welding wire at feed speed, generating short-circuit intervals and arc intervals, during which arc intervals, application of a first welding current is followed by application of a second welding current smaller than the first welding current, wherein the phase of the feed speed at the point in time of transition from an arc interval to a short-circuit interval is detected, and the value and/or the application duration of the first welding current is varied in accordance with the detected phase. In so doing, fluctuation of the phase of the feed speed due to outside disturbances during generation of short-circuiting can be minimized.Type: GrantFiled: April 1, 2015Date of Patent: October 29, 2019Assignee: DAIHEN CORPORATIONInventor: Akihiro Ide
